How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ide Actually Works

The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ide begins with verifying compatibility between the plow and the vehicle’s front-end system. This includes checking mounting points, bracket design, and hydraulic or electric lift mechanisms, depending on the chosen plow type. Preparation is key, so the process often recommends parking on level ground, engaging the parking brake, and wearing appropriate safety gear. Next, the existing front assembly may be removed or adapted, and the mounting brackets are carefully aligned and secured with high-grade fasteners. Correct alignment ensures even weight distribution and minimizes stress on the vehicle’s frame. Once bolted in place, the plow’s hydraulic or electric connections are tested for smooth operation, followed by a cautious initial lift to confirm functionality. A structured step-by-step approach reduces guesswork and supports confident execution, even for beginners.

What Tools Do I Need for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ation?

Having the right tools is essential for a smooth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ide. Most installations require a basic set of hand tools, including wrenches, sockets, and screwdrivers that match the hardware provided with the plow. A torque wrench is highly recommended to ensure bolts are tightened to the manufacturer’s specifications, which helps prevent damage and improves safety. In many cases, a small hydraulic or electric pump is needed if the plow uses a separate hydraulic system, while other models may integrate with the vehicle’s existing hydraulics. Extension bars and a pry bar can assist with initial alignment, and a digital level or inclinometer may be useful for verifying the plow blade is properly adjusted. For users who prefer additional support, a helper can make handling larger components easier and improve overall safety during the process.

How Long Does a Typical Installation Take?

The time required for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ide can vary based on experience level, the complexity of the plow system, and preparation. For someone familiar with vehicle maintenance, a straightforward installation may take between two and four hours. Beginners or those using more complex hydraulic models might need six hours or longer, especially when adjusting to new techniques. Breaking the work into smaller sessions can help maintain focus and accuracy, such as completing mechanical mounting on one day and finishing electrical or hydraulic calibration the next. Scheduling adequate time reduces pressure and supports careful attention to detail, which ultimately leads to a safer, more dependable result.

Will Installing a Snow Plow Void My Vehicle Warranty?

Concerns about warranty impact are common when considering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ide. In many cases, installing an aftermarket plow does not automatically void the entire vehicle warranty, especially if the work is done carefully and without negligence. However, improper installation that causes damage to the front-end structure, wiring, or suspension could lead to denied claims in that specific area. It is wise to review the vehicle’s warranty terms and, when possible, have the installation performed or verified by a qualified technician. Keeping records of parts, labor, and alignment checks can provide protection and peace of mind.

Can a Snow Plow Be Removed Easily When Not in Use?

Most plow systems designed for the Can-Am Defender allow for seasonal removal, which is an important consideration in the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ide. Quick-release brackets or pin-style connections enable users to detach the plow when winter passes, restoring the vehicle’s original utility. Regular maintenance, such as cleaning and light lubrication, helps ensure that mounting points remain free of debris and corrosion. Storing the plow in a dry location further extends its lifespan and keeps components ready for the next season. The ability to remove and store the unit adds long-term value to the investment.

Do I Need Special Driving Skills to Use a Snow Plow?

Operating a vehicle equipped with a snow plow does require some adjustment, which is addressed within the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ide. The added weight and width influence handling, especially during turns and at low speeds. Drivers are generally advised to reduce speed, increase following distance, and avoid sudden steering inputs. Practicing in an open, unused area before tackling busy roads can build confidence and improve control. While no special certification is typically required, experience and mindful driving habits contribute significantly to safety and effectiveness.

Things People Often Misunderstand

Misinformation can create unnecessary hesitation or false confidence, which is why clarifying misunderstandings is essential in any Can-Am Defender Snow Plow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ide. One common myth is that any plow will fit any Defender model, when in reality, compatibility depends on frame design, axle configuration, and lift capacity. Another misunderstanding is that installation is a purely mechanical task, when planning for wiring, fluid lines, and balance is equally important. Some users assume that larger blades are always better, yet choosing a size that matches local conditions and vehicle capacity often leads to better results. Recognizing these nuances supports safer, more satisfying outcomes.
